The Way of Tarot is not your typical guidebook. Co-authored by his long-time collaborator Marianne Costa, the book presents a radical and holistic vision of the Tarot de Marseille. Its central philosophy is that the entire 78-card deck is not a random collection, but a cohesive or a "mandala" . This sacred structure is meant to be an image of the world and a map of the divine.
